Super Sized to Shrinky Products


They Super sized us to near death for the last ten years or so and now they are shrinking the original size of things... hmm. Did you realize that years ago you would buy a half gallon of ice cream. Well, then in 2003 in went down to 1.75 quarts.... now in 2008 we have shrunk to 1.5 quarts. Yep it's happening.

They are shrinking the candy bars also. A normal sized Candy bar since the beginning of time is no longer... A normal snickers bar is now smaller. You can grab hold of one and feel the difference...I don't know the exact ounces.

It's all fine with me. But if they are going to give us less then why is the price even higher than before. Hmm that is the part I don't like. Now when you have that birthday party and need ice cream you may end up buying 3 containers of ice cream instead of 2 to feed everyone.
